Important Added Info: Note that first release one-sheets from this most classic movie are incredibly rare! Perhaps this is related to the movie being re-released in 1949, which would have used up most of the surviving first release paper. In any event, we auctioned a style A one-sheet in 1992, and after that, we did not auction another first release one-sheet until 2017, when we auctioned a style C one-sheet. Now, for the first time, we are auctioning this style B one-sheet, which means that after this auction, we will have auctioned one of each of the three styles one time each in all our years of auctioning, and that shows how incredibly rare first release one-sheets are!

Overall Condition and Pre-Restoration Defects with Quality of Restoration: good. The poster had tears and areas of paper loss in all four borders that slightly extended into the background in several places, and there was a diagonal area of paper loss in the top right corner of the image, extending 2" into the yellow background at top right, and then continuing diagonally down to the right side of the yellow sign the person is holding (near the top of the crowd). There were also tears and areas of paper loss scattered down the center, and some along the other folds, with a few areas of paper loss scattered in the rest of the poster. Overall, the poster was in fair to good condition prior to linenbacking. A really talented restorer did a wonderful job repairing the above defects, working off of a high quality image taken of another example of the poster decades ago. While you can see slight signs of the defects the poster has had, virtually no one would realize the amount of restoration it has had, and the poster will display wonderfully on the new owner's wall.
